Transaction 366feaf81d4529f064d768d40ca65cb90be7c59c563a86a4b4f3a13eb0e6e5e1

1 Input
2 Outputs
  • 366feaf81d4529f064d768d40ca65cb90be7c59c563a86a4b4f3a13eb0e6e5e1:0
  • value  345327
    address  35sNkAsn3aBWZBT9rvy4MmaJtXyEKEHTME
  • 366feaf81d4529f064d768d40ca65cb90be7c59c563a86a4b4f3a13eb0e6e5e1:1
  • value  109320052
    address  36HV7RzMRyuqjFTd6jcpA52gNxDi9dpZrd